Privacy: The Double-Edged Sword
One of the primary concerns with storing biometrics on a ledger is privacy. Biometric data is deeply personal, and its misuse can lead to significant harm. Unlike passwords, which can be changed, biometric traits are immutable. This permanence raises the stakes significantly.
The ledger's immutable nature means that once data is stored, it cannot be altered or deleted. This feature is beneficial for ensuring data integrity and preventing fraud but poses a significant risk in terms of privacy. If biometric data is compromised, the damage is potentially permanent.
Security Considerations
Security is another critical aspect. Ledger technology promises a high level of security due to its decentralized nature and cryptographic techniques. However, the decentralized aspect also means that the responsibility for data security is distributed across a network rather than centralized under a single entity. This decentralization, while advantageous in preventing single points of failure, introduces complexity in managing and securing data.
When biometric data is stored on a ledger, the risk of a large-scale data breach is mitigated because the data is dispersed across multiple nodes. However, the security of each node must be rigorously maintained. If one node is compromised, it could potentially lead to a chain reaction affecting the entire ledger.

Technological Challenges
The technological challenges of storing biometrics on a ledger are multifaceted. One of the most pressing issues is the sheer volume of data. Biometric data, especially when considering high-resolution images or audio samples, can be substantial. Ledgers, particularly blockchain, are designed to handle transactions efficiently, but storing large volumes of biometric data poses a different set of challenges.
Scalability is a major concern. As the number of users increases, the ledger must handle a growing amount of data without compromising on speed or security. This necessitates advancements in storage technology and efficient data compression techniques to ensure that the ledger can grow alongside the demand.
Another technological hurdle is the integration of biometric data with existing systems. Many organizations already have established databases and systems for managing user data. Integrating biometric data stored on a ledger with these existing systems requires robust and seamless interoperability.
Regulatory Challenges
The regulatory landscape for biometric data storage is still evolving. Unlike other forms of personal data, biometrics are deeply personal and immutable. This unique nature necessitates stringent regulatory frameworks to protect individuals from misuse.
One of the primary regulatory challenges is the establishment of global standards. Different countries have varying laws and regulations concerning biometric data. Creating a universal standard that respects these differences while ensuring robust protection is a complex task.
Data protection regulations, such as the General Data Protection Regulation (GDPR) in Europe, provide a framework for handling personal data. However, applying these regulations to biometric data stored on a ledger requires careful consideration to ensure compliance without compromising on the benefits of the technology.

Furthermore, the world of crypto offers innovative ways to earn and manage your money that go beyond simple buying and selling. Decentralized Finance, or DeFi, is a burgeoning sector aiming to recreate traditional financial services – lending, borrowing, insurance – on blockchain technology, without intermediaries. Mastering DeFi involves understanding concepts like liquidity pools, yield farming, and staking. Staking, for instance, is a way to earn rewards by holding and supporting a blockchain network. These opportunities can provide passive income streams, but they also come with their own set of risks, including smart contract vulnerabilities and impermanent loss in liquidity provision. Developing the skill to assess these opportunities, understand their mechanisms, and manage the associated risks is a sign of advanced Crypto Money Skills.
Finally, and perhaps most critically, are the skills related to security. The decentralized nature of crypto means that users are often their own custodians of their assets. This is both empowering and demanding. Understanding digital wallets – hot wallets (connected to the internet) and cold wallets (offline) – is fundamental. Learning about private keys and seed phrases, and the absolute necessity of keeping them secure and private, is non-negotiable. Phishing scams, malware, and rogue exchanges are ever-present threats. Developing robust cybersecurity practices, such as using strong, unique passwords, enabling two-factor authentication, and being wary of unsolicited offers or requests, are vital Crypto Money Skills. It’s about building a digital fortress around your assets, ensuring that your investment journey isn’t derailed by preventable security breaches.

When it comes to actually acquiring and managing digital assets, a crucial Crypto Money Skill is understanding the various platforms and methods available. This includes navigating cryptocurrency exchanges, both centralized (like Binance or Coinbase) and decentralized (like Uniswap or SushiSwap). Each has its own pros and cons regarding ease of use, security, fees, and the range of assets offered. Centralized exchanges are generally more user-friendly for beginners, but you relinquish some control over your assets by entrusting them to the exchange. Decentralized exchanges offer greater autonomy but can be more complex to navigate. Beyond exchanges, you'll encounter protocols for direct peer-to-peer transactions, often facilitated by smart contracts. Learning to use these platforms safely, understanding transaction fees (gas fees), and knowing how to withdraw assets to your own secure wallet are all integral parts of your Crypto Money Skills.
